'Trolley Man' was bailed on strict conditions

Michael Rogers, known as Trolley Man, was bailed on strict conditions, including curfews and away from CBD.

Michael Rogers, 46, attempted to help police officers stop Hassan Khalif Shire Ali during Friday’s Bourke Street terror attack.

Source: 7 news

'Trolley Man' Michael Rogers has to stay away from Melbourne CBD, and stays home from 9pm to 6am in exchange for his freedom.
